SENATE RESOLUTION NO. 103
WHEREAS, The Senate of the State of Texas is pleased to recognize William-Paul Dunbar Thomas for his years of service to the Texas Senate; and WHEREAS, William-Paul Thomas was the district office director for Senator Rodney Ellis from 1990 to 2000; and WHEREAS, William-Paul grew up in the Third Ward in Houston; he served in the United States Air Force as an emergency service specialist in California and returned to Houston to attend Texas Southern University; and WHEREAS, He was a student leader at Texas Southern University when he met then Houston City Council member Rodney Ellis; that meeting began the political career that would take him to Washington, D.C., to work for United States Representative William Gray III, chairman of the House Budget Committee; and WHEREAS, When he returned to Houston, Mr. Thomas immersed himself in public service; he served as district director for United States Senator Bob Krueger, and he worked in the two successful campaigns of President Bill Clinton; and WHEREAS, William-Paul Thomas currently serves as Texas Bureau Chief in Houston for the Wall Street Project, a continuation of Reverend Jesse Jackson's lifework, the Rainbow/PUSH Coalition; the project's mission is to promote inclusion, opportunity, and economic growth for underserved populations; and WHEREAS, Fourteen years ago, William-Paul married his high school sweetheart, Chanthini, and the couple has two sons, William-Paul II and Ryan Alexander; and WHEREAS, Mr. Thomas serves on the boards of numerous organizations in Houston, and he is a member of Alpha Phi Alpha Fraternity and the Wheeler Avenue Baptist Church; an exemplary public servant, William-Paul brings honor to himself, his community, and the State of Texas; now, therefore, be it RESOLVED, That the Senate of the State of Texas, 78th Legislature, hereby recognize William-Paul Dunbar Thomas for his contributions to the Texas Senate and the citizens of Texas; and, be it further RESOLVED, That a copy of this Resolution be prepared for him as an expression of high regard from the Texas Senate.
